-void QDirectFBPaintEngine::drawImage(const QRectF &r, const QImage &image,
- const QRectF &sr,
- Qt::ImageConversionFlags flags)
-{
- Q_D(QDirectFBPaintEngine);
- Q_UNUSED(flags);
-
- /* This is hard to read. The way it works is like this:
-
- - If you do not have support for preallocated surfaces and do not use an
- image cache we always fall back to raster engine.
-
- - If it's rotated/sheared/mirrored (negative scale) or we can't
- clip it we fall back to raster engine.
-
- - If we don't cache the image, but we do have support for
- preallocated surfaces we fall back to the raster engine if the
- image is in a format DirectFB can't handle.
-
- - If we do cache the image but don't have support for preallocated
- images and the cost of caching the image (bytes used) is higher
- than the max image cache size we fall back to raster engine.
- */
-
-#if !defined QT_NO_DIRECTFB_PREALLOCATED || defined QT_DIRECTFB_IMAGECACHE
- if (!(d->compositionModeStatus & QDirectFBPaintEnginePrivate::PorterDuff_Supported)
- || (d->transformationType & QDirectFBPaintEnginePrivate::Matrix_BlitsUnsupported)
- || (d->clipType == QDirectFBPaintEnginePrivate::ComplexClip)
- || (!d->supportsStretchBlit() && state()->matrix.mapRect(r).size() != sr.size())
-#ifndef QT_DIRECTFB_IMAGECACHE
- || (QDirectFBScreen::getSurfacePixelFormat(image.format()) == DSPF_UNKNOWN)
-#elif defined QT_NO_DIRECTFB_PREALLOCATED
- || (QDirectFBPaintEnginePrivate::cacheCost(image) > imageCache.maxCost())
-#endif
- )
-#endif
- {
- RASTERFALLBACK(DRAW_IMAGE, r, image.size(), sr);
- d->lock();
- QRasterPaintEngine::drawImage(r, image, sr, flags);
- return;
- }
-#if !defined QT_NO_DIRECTFB_PREALLOCATED || defined QT_DIRECTFB_IMAGECACHE
- bool release;
- IDirectFBSurface *imgSurface = d->getSurface(image, &release);
- uint blitFlags = 0;
- if (image.hasAlphaChannel())
- blitFlags |= QDirectFBPaintEnginePrivate::HasAlpha;
- if (QDirectFBScreen::isPremultiplied(image.format()))
- blitFlags |= QDirectFBPaintEnginePrivate::Premultiplied;
- d->prepareForBlit(blitFlags);
- CLIPPED_PAINT(d->blit(r, imgSurface, sr));
- if (release) {
-#if (Q_DIRECTFB_VERSION >= 0x010000)
- d->surface->ReleaseSource(d->surface);
-#endif
- imgSurface->Release(imgSurface);
- }
-#endif
-}
